Your key responsibilities

  • As a Business Analyst, you will work with our clients to understand business goals and priorities, and to work with functional teams to formulate solutions to meet these goals.
  • You will build valuable relationships with our clients through demonstrating exceptional delivery.
  • You’ll also have the responsibility to help grow and win new business by contributing to proposals and client presentations.
  • You will also get to draw on your skills and experience, creating innovative insights for clients looking to develop their change agenda to deliver value and improve their operations.

Skills and attributes for success

  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ills
  • Keen attention to detail
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• Eager to build valued relationships with both our clients and your peers across EY
  • Strong drive to excel professionally, and to guide and motivate others
  • Strives to identify new opportunities and to create proposals to help solve our client’s most complex problems
  • Passion for developing people through effectively coaching and mentoring more junior members of staff
  • A continued ambition to further develop and learn, fostering an interest in innovative technologies

To qualify for the role, you must have:

  • At least 2 years' experience working within a consulting firm, industry or government organisation within local, European & US markets
  • Experience gathering, defining and documenting business and solution requirements for the enhancement, replacement, or introduction of IT systems
  • A strong academic record including a third level degree
  • Experience in one or more of our focus industries including Power & Utilities, Government & Public Sector, Financial Services, Life Sciences and Telecommunications & Media
  • Experience operating in a fast paced, multi-vendor environment in a client facing role
  • Experience in business development such as client relationship management and proposal support

Ideally, you also will have:

  • Experience analysing systems and procedures, process design and modelling, and documenting ‘As is’ and ‘To be’ assessments for a Target Operating Model
  • Experience in Waterfall and Agile methodologies, including the creation of User Stories or Use Cases and working closely with a Product Owner
  • Experience conducting workshops and interviews
  • Experience with stakeholder management and working collaboratively with Development and Testing teams to deliver high quality solutions that meet client and user business needs
  • Experience in the delivery of large-scale business/technology programmes and ideally in ERP or CRM implementations (Oracle, MS Dynamics, SAP)
